What is a Learning Pod?

A learning pod is an association of parents who choose the program to support their homeschooling journey! Every child enrolled at The Learning Light is a homeschooler through the state of Georgia. We believe that parents should have choice in their child’s education and be the primary influencer. The Learning Light will provide support to meet the Georgia homeschooling laws. A learning pod allows for smaller class sizes, parent involvement, and individualized learning. Our learning pod will provide instruction in mathematics, reading, language arts, science, and social studies along with biblical teachings. What are the GA Homeschooling Laws?

4.5 hour days with a school year including 180 days
Submit a Declaration of Intent for ages 6-16
Maintain Progress Reports
Core Curriculum including reading, language arts, mathematics, science, and social studies
Standardized Testing for 3rd grade and every 3 years after that
